The digestive system consists of several organs that work together to process and absorb nutrients from the food we eat. The stomach and small intestines are two crucial components of this system.

The stomach's main function is to break down food mechanically and chemically through the release of enzymes and stomach acid. This process helps start the digestion of proteins. The muscular walls of the stomach contract and relax to churn and mix the food, assisting in the mechanical breakdown.

However, most of the digestion and nutrient absorption occurs in the small intestines. The small intestines play a vital role in breaking down the food into smaller molecules and absorbing nutrients into the bloodstream. The muscular walls of the small intestines have tiny finger-like projections called villi, which increase the surface area for absorption.

The contraction and relaxation of the muscles in the stomach and small intestines are facilitated by the muscular system. These muscle movements, known as peristalsis, help propel the food from the stomach to the small intestines and aid in the mixing and breakdown of food.
